Winner, 39th National Book Award for Best Book on Humor, Sports, and Lifestyle

The City of Manila is rich with heritage buildings characterized by their artistic, historical, cultural and age values. From this treasure of heritage sites, Walk Manila identifies 100 historic sites and structures that still stand today in the different districts — Intramuros, Port Area, Ermita, Malate, Paco, Santa Ana, Pandacan, Binondo, San Nicolas, Tondo, Santa Cruz, Quiapo, San Miguel, Sampaloc and Santa Mesa. Prioritized are those recognized and declared by government cultural agencies such as the National Historical Commission of the Philippines, National Museum of the Philippines and the Intramuros Administration. These include National Historical Landmarks, National Shrines, National Monuments, Classified Historic Sites and Structures, National Cultural Treasures and Important Cultural Properties.

Among these are those that have been installed with historical and heritage markers, those deemed as heritage-at-risk, and those that represent the district's unique cultural heritage.

Walk Manila comes with maps and tours developed by the FEU Guides, the University's official tour guides and ushers. The tours of the various districts start in sites nearest to an LRT station with commuters in mind. It is possible to drive to the starting points and find parking nearby.

Published in 2019 by Far Eastern University

160 pages
